60 /*******************************************************************************
61  *
62  * FUNCTION:    acpi_ex_store
63  *
64  * PARAMETERS:  *source_desc        - Value to be stored
65  *              *dest_desc          - Where to store it. Must be an NS node
66  *                                    or union acpi_operand_object of type
67  *                                    Reference;
68  *              walk_state          - Current walk state
69  *
70  * RETURN:      Status
71  *
72  * DESCRIPTION: Store the value described by source_desc into the location
73  *              described by dest_desc. Called by various interpreter
74  *              functions to store the result of an operation into
75  *              the destination operand -- not just simply the actual "Store"
76  *              ASL operator.
77  *
78  ******************************************************************************/
79
80 acpi_status
81 acpi_ex_store(union acpi_operand_object *source_desc,
82               union acpi_operand_object *dest_desc,
83               struct acpi_walk_state *walk_state)
84 {
85         acpi_status status = AE_OK;
86         union acpi_operand_object *ref_desc = dest_desc;
87
88         ACPI_FUNCTION_TRACE_PTR(ex_store, dest_desc);
89
90         /* Validate parameters */
91
92         if (!source_desc || !dest_desc) {
93                 ACPI_ERROR((AE_INFO, "Null parameter"));
94                 return_ACPI_STATUS(AE_AML_NO_OPERAND);
95         }
96
97         /* dest_desc can be either a namespace node or an ACPI object */
98
99         if (ACPI_GET_DESCRIPTOR_TYPE(dest_desc) == ACPI_DESC_TYPE_NAMED) {
100                 /*
101                  * Dest is a namespace node,
102                  * Storing an object into a Named node.
103                  */
104                 status = acpi_ex_store_object_to_node(source_desc,
105                                                       (struct
106                                                        acpi_namespace_node *)
107                                                       dest_desc, walk_state,
108                                                       ACPI_IMPLICIT_CONVERSION);
109
110                 return_ACPI_STATUS(status);
111         }
112
113         /* Destination object must be a Reference or a Constant object */
114
115         switch (dest_desc->common.type) {
116         case ACPI_TYPE_LOCAL_REFERENCE:
117
118                 break;
119
120         case ACPI_TYPE_INTEGER:
121
122                 /* Allow stores to Constants -- a Noop as per ACPI spec */
123
124                 if (dest_desc->common.flags & AOPOBJ_AML_CONSTANT) {
125                         return_ACPI_STATUS(AE_OK);
126                 }
127
128                 /*lint -fallthrough */
129
130         default:
131
132                 /* Destination is not a Reference object */
133
134                 ACPI_ERROR((AE_INFO,
135                             "Target is not a Reference or Constant object - %s [%p]",
136                             acpi_ut_get_object_type_name(dest_desc),
137                             dest_desc));
138
139                 return_ACPI_STATUS(AE_AML_OPERAND_TYPE);
140         }
141
142         /*
143          * Examine the Reference class. These cases are handled:
144          *
145          * 1) Store to Name (Change the object associated with a name)
146          * 2) Store to an indexed area of a Buffer or Package
147          * 3) Store to a Method Local or Arg
148          * 4) Store to the debug object
149          */
150         switch (ref_desc->reference.class) {
151         case ACPI_REFCLASS_REFOF:
152
153                 /* Storing an object into a Name "container" */
154
155                 status = acpi_ex_store_object_to_node(source_desc,
156                                                       ref_desc->reference.
157                                                       object, walk_state,
158                                                       ACPI_IMPLICIT_CONVERSION);
159                 break;
160
161         case ACPI_REFCLASS_INDEX:
162
163                 /* Storing to an Index (pointer into a packager or buffer) */
164
165                 status =
166                     acpi_ex_store_object_to_index(source_desc, ref_desc,
167                                                   walk_state);
168                 break;
169
170         case ACPI_REFCLASS_LOCAL:
171         case ACPI_REFCLASS_ARG:
172
173                 /* Store to a method local/arg  */
174
175                 status =
176                     acpi_ds_store_object_to_local(ref_desc->reference.class,
177                                                   ref_desc->reference.value,
178                                                   source_desc, walk_state);
179                 break;
180
181         case ACPI_REFCLASS_DEBUG:
182                 /*
183                  * Storing to the Debug object causes the value stored to be
184                  * displayed and otherwise has no effect -- see ACPI Specification
185                  */
186                 ACPI_DEBUG_PRINT((ACPI_DB_EXEC,
187                                   "**** Write to Debug Object: Object %p %s ****:\n\n",
188                                   source_desc,
189                                   acpi_ut_get_object_type_name(source_desc)));
190
191                 ACPI_DEBUG_OBJECT(source_desc, 0, 0);
192                 break;
193
194         default:
195
196                 ACPI_ERROR((AE_INFO, "Unknown Reference Class 0x%2.2X",
197                             ref_desc->reference.class));
198                 ACPI_DUMP_ENTRY(ref_desc, ACPI_LV_INFO);
199
200                 status = AE_AML_INTERNAL;
201                 break;
202         }
203
204         return_ACPI_STATUS(status);
205 }

207 /*******************************************************************************
208  *
209  * FUNCTION:    acpi_ex_store_object_to_index
210  *
211  * PARAMETERS:  *source_desc            - Value to be stored
212  *              *dest_desc              - Named object to receive the value
213  *              walk_state              - Current walk state
214  *
215  * RETURN:      Status
216  *
217  * DESCRIPTION: Store the object to indexed Buffer or Package element
218  *
219  ******************************************************************************/
220
221 static acpi_status
222 acpi_ex_store_object_to_index(union acpi_operand_object *source_desc,
223                               union acpi_operand_object *index_desc,
224                               struct acpi_walk_state *walk_state)
225 {
226         acpi_status status = AE_OK;
227         union acpi_operand_object *obj_desc;
228         union acpi_operand_object *new_desc;
229         u8 value = 0;
230         u32 i;
231
232         ACPI_FUNCTION_TRACE(ex_store_object_to_index);
233
234         /*
235          * Destination must be a reference pointer, and
236          * must point to either a buffer or a package
237          */
238         switch (index_desc->reference.target_type) {
239         case ACPI_TYPE_PACKAGE:
240                 /*
241                  * Storing to a package element. Copy the object and replace
242                  * any existing object with the new object. No implicit
243                  * conversion is performed.
244                  *
245                  * The object at *(index_desc->Reference.Where) is the
246                  * element within the package that is to be modified.
247                  * The parent package object is at index_desc->Reference.Object
248                  */
249                 obj_desc = *(index_desc->reference.where);
250
251                 if (source_desc->common.type == ACPI_TYPE_LOCAL_REFERENCE &&
252                     source_desc->reference.class == ACPI_REFCLASS_TABLE) {
253
254                         /* This is a DDBHandle, just add a reference to it */
255
256                         acpi_ut_add_reference(source_desc);
257                         new_desc = source_desc;
258                 } else {
259                         /* Normal object, copy it */
260
261                         status =
262                             acpi_ut_copy_iobject_to_iobject(source_desc,
263                                                             &new_desc,
264                                                             walk_state);
265                         if (ACPI_FAILURE(status)) {
266                                 return_ACPI_STATUS(status);
267                         }
268                 }
269
270                 if (obj_desc) {
271
272                         /* Decrement reference count by the ref count of the parent package */
273
274                         for (i = 0; i < ((union acpi_operand_object *)
275                                          index_desc->reference.object)->common.
276                              reference_count; i++) {
277                                 acpi_ut_remove_reference(obj_desc);
278                         }
279                 }
280
281                 *(index_desc->reference.where) = new_desc;
282
283                 /* Increment ref count by the ref count of the parent package-1 */
284
285                 for (i = 1; i < ((union acpi_operand_object *)
286                                  index_desc->reference.object)->common.
287                      reference_count; i++) {
288                         acpi_ut_add_reference(new_desc);
289                 }
290
291                 break;
292
293         case ACPI_TYPE_BUFFER_FIELD:
294                 /*
295                  * Store into a Buffer or String (not actually a real buffer_field)
296                  * at a location defined by an Index.
297                  *
298                  * The first 8-bit element of the source object is written to the
299                  * 8-bit Buffer location defined by the Index destination object,
300                  * according to the ACPI 2.0 specification.
301                  */
302
303                 /*
304                  * Make sure the target is a Buffer or String. An error should
305                  * not happen here, since the reference_object was constructed
306                  * by the INDEX_OP code.
307                  */
308                 obj_desc = index_desc->reference.object;
309                 if ((obj_desc->common.type != ACPI_TYPE_BUFFER) &&
310                     (obj_desc->common.type != ACPI_TYPE_STRING)) {
311                         return_ACPI_STATUS(AE_AML_OPERAND_TYPE);
312                 }
313
314                 /*
315                  * The assignment of the individual elements will be slightly
316                  * different for each source type.
317                  */
318                 switch (source_desc->common.type) {
319                 case ACPI_TYPE_INTEGER:
320
321                         /* Use the least-significant byte of the integer */
322
323                         value = (u8) (source_desc->integer.value);
324                         break;
325
326                 case ACPI_TYPE_BUFFER:
327                 case ACPI_TYPE_STRING:
328
329                         /* Note: Takes advantage of common string/buffer fields */
330
331                         value = source_desc->buffer.pointer[0];
332                         break;
333
334                 default:
335
336                         /* All other types are invalid */
337
338                         ACPI_ERROR((AE_INFO,
339                                     "Source must be Integer/Buffer/String type, not %s",
340                                     acpi_ut_get_object_type_name(source_desc)));
341                         return_ACPI_STATUS(AE_AML_OPERAND_TYPE);
342                 }
343
344                 /* Store the source value into the target buffer byte */
345
346                 obj_desc->buffer.pointer[index_desc->reference.value] = value;
347                 break;
348
349         default:
350                 ACPI_ERROR((AE_INFO, "Target is not a Package or BufferField"));
351                 status = AE_AML_OPERAND_TYPE;
352                 break;
353         }
354
355         return_ACPI_STATUS(status);
356 }

358 /*******************************************************************************
359  *
360  * FUNCTION:    acpi_ex_store_object_to_node
361  *
362  * PARAMETERS:  source_desc             - Value to be stored
363  *              node                    - Named object to receive the value
364  *              walk_state              - Current walk state
365  *              implicit_conversion     - Perform implicit conversion (yes/no)
366  *
367  * RETURN:      Status
368  *
369  * DESCRIPTION: Store the object to the named object.
370  *
371  *              The Assignment of an object to a named object is handled here
372  *              The value passed in will replace the current value (if any)
373  *              with the input value.
374  *
375  *              When storing into an object the data is converted to the
376  *              target object type then stored in the object. This means
377  *              that the target object type (for an initialized target) will
378  *              not be changed by a store operation.
379  *
380  *              Assumes parameters are already validated.
381  *
382  ******************************************************************************/
383
384 acpi_status
385 acpi_ex_store_object_to_node(union acpi_operand_object *source_desc,
386                              struct acpi_namespace_node *node,
387                              struct acpi_walk_state *walk_state,
388                              u8 implicit_conversion)
389 {
390         acpi_status status = AE_OK;
391         union acpi_operand_object *target_desc;
392         union acpi_operand_object *new_desc;
393         acpi_object_type target_type;
394
395         ACPI_FUNCTION_TRACE_PTR(ex_store_object_to_node, source_desc);
396
397         /* Get current type of the node, and object attached to Node */
398
399         target_type = acpi_ns_get_type(node);
400         target_desc = acpi_ns_get_attached_object(node);
401
402         ACPI_DEBUG_PRINT((ACPI_DB_EXEC, "Storing %p(%s) into node %p(%s)\n",
403                           source_desc,
404                           acpi_ut_get_object_type_name(source_desc), node,
405                           acpi_ut_get_type_name(target_type)));
406
407         /*
408          * Resolve the source object to an actual value
409          * (If it is a reference object)
410          */
411         status = acpi_ex_resolve_object(&source_desc, target_type, walk_state);
412         if (ACPI_FAILURE(status)) {
413                 return_ACPI_STATUS(status);
414         }
415
416         /* If no implicit conversion, drop into the default case below */
417
418         if ((!implicit_conversion) ||
419             ((walk_state->opcode == AML_COPY_OP) &&
420              (target_type != ACPI_TYPE_LOCAL_REGION_FIELD) &&
421              (target_type != ACPI_TYPE_LOCAL_BANK_FIELD) &&
422              (target_type != ACPI_TYPE_LOCAL_INDEX_FIELD))) {
423                 /*
424                  * Force execution of default (no implicit conversion). Note:
425                  * copy_object does not perform an implicit conversion, as per the ACPI
426                  * spec -- except in case of region/bank/index fields -- because these
427                  * objects must retain their original type permanently.
428                  */
429                 target_type = ACPI_TYPE_ANY;
430         }
431
432         /* Do the actual store operation */
433
434         switch (target_type) {
435         case ACPI_TYPE_BUFFER_FIELD:
436         case ACPI_TYPE_LOCAL_REGION_FIELD:
437         case ACPI_TYPE_LOCAL_BANK_FIELD:
438         case ACPI_TYPE_LOCAL_INDEX_FIELD:
439
440                 /* For fields, copy the source data to the target field. */
441
442                 status = acpi_ex_write_data_to_field(source_desc, target_desc,
443                                                      &walk_state->result_obj);
444                 break;
445
446         case ACPI_TYPE_INTEGER:
447         case ACPI_TYPE_STRING:
448         case ACPI_TYPE_BUFFER:
449                 /*
450                  * These target types are all of type Integer/String/Buffer, and
451                  * therefore support implicit conversion before the store.
452                  *
453                  * Copy and/or convert the source object to a new target object
454                  */
455                 status =
456                     acpi_ex_store_object_to_object(source_desc, target_desc,
457                                                    &new_desc, walk_state);
458                 if (ACPI_FAILURE(status)) {
459                         return_ACPI_STATUS(status);
460                 }
461
462                 if (new_desc != target_desc) {
463                         /*
464                          * Store the new new_desc as the new value of the Name, and set
465                          * the Name's type to that of the value being stored in it.
466                          * source_desc reference count is incremented by attach_object.
467                          *
468                          * Note: This may change the type of the node if an explicit store
469                          * has been performed such that the node/object type has been
470                          * changed.
471                          */
472                         status =
473                             acpi_ns_attach_object(node, new_desc,
474                                                   new_desc->common.type);
475
476                         ACPI_DEBUG_PRINT((ACPI_DB_EXEC,
477                                           "Store %s into %s via Convert/Attach\n",
478                                           acpi_ut_get_object_type_name
479                                           (source_desc),
480                                           acpi_ut_get_object_type_name
481                                           (new_desc)));
482                 }
483                 break;
484
485         default:
486
487                 ACPI_DEBUG_PRINT((ACPI_DB_EXEC,
488                                   "Storing [%s] (%p) directly into node [%s] (%p)"
489                                   " with no implicit conversion\n",
490                                   acpi_ut_get_object_type_name(source_desc),
491                                   source_desc,
492                                   acpi_ut_get_object_type_name(target_desc),
493                                   node));
494
495                 /*
496                  * No conversions for all other types. Directly store a copy of
497                  * the source object. NOTE: This is a departure from the ACPI
498                  * spec, which states "If conversion is impossible, abort the
499                  * running control method".
500                  *
501                  * This code implements "If conversion is impossible, treat the
502                  * Store operation as a CopyObject".
503                  */
504                 status =
505                     acpi_ut_copy_iobject_to_iobject(source_desc, &new_desc,
506                                                     walk_state);
507                 if (ACPI_FAILURE(status)) {
508                         return_ACPI_STATUS(status);
509                 }
510
511                 status =
512                     acpi_ns_attach_object(node, new_desc,
513                                           new_desc->common.type);
514                 acpi_ut_remove_reference(new_desc);
515                 break;
516         }
517
518         return_ACPI_STATUS(status);
519 }
